Nanotechnology has several applications in all stages of manufacturing, handling, saving, product packaging and transportation of farming items. Making use of nanotechnology in agriculture and also forestry will likely have ecological advantages (Froggett, 2009). Farm applications of nanotechnology are additionally powerful interest. Nano materials are being established that use the possibility to more effectively as well as safely provide chemicals, herbicides, as well as fertilizers by controlling exactly when as well as where they are released (Kuzma and VerHage, 2006). Nanotechnology as a brand-new powerful technology has the ability to produce massive modifications in food and also farming systems. Nanotechnology is able to present brand-new devices for usage in cellular and also molecular biology and also new materials to identify plant virus. Hitherto many applications of nanotechnology in farming, food as well as pet sciences, has actually been suggested. Use of nanotechnology in agriculture and food sector can reinvent the field with brand-new devices for condition detection, targeted treatment, boosting the capability of plants to absorb nutrients, fight diseases as well as withstand ecological pressures and also effective systems for processing, storage space and product packaging. Nanotechnology has actually provided brand-new options to problems in plants and food scientific research (post-harvest products) and also offers new techniques to the rational choice of basic materials, or the handling of such products to improve the high quality of plant items (Sharon et al., 2010). Smart sensors as well as smart distribution systems will certainly help the farming sector combat viruses and also other plant pathogens. In the future nanostructured stimulants will certainly be offered which will boost the efficiency of pesticides and herbicides enabling lower doses to be utilized. Nanotechnology will certainly likewise safeguard the environment indirectly through making use of option (sustainable) power products, and filters or stimulants to decrease pollution and also clean-up existing toxins (Joseph as well as Morrison, 2006). In the agricultural field, nanotechnology research and development is most likely to facilitate and also frame the next stage of advancement of genetically changed crops, pet manufacturing inputs, chemical pesticides and also accuracy farming strategies. Precision agriculture means that there is a system controller for every development aspect such as nutrition, light, temperature, and so on. Readily available Information for growing and harvest are managed by satellite systems. This system permits the farmer to understand, when is the very best time for growing and harvesting to avoid of experiencing bad weather conditions. Finest time to accomplish the greatest return, ideal use fertilizers, watering, illumination as well as temperature are all controlled by these systems. A vital nanotechnology role is using sensitive nuclear web links in GPS systems controller. While nano-chemical pesticides are already in use, various other applications are still in their onset, and also it might be several years prior to they are advertised. These applications are largely meant to address some of the constraints and also obstacles dealing with large-scale, chemical and capital intensive farming systems. This includes the fine-tuning and more exact micromanagement of soils; the extra reliable and targeted use inputs; new contaminant formulas for insect control; new crop and also pet qualities; and also the diversity and also differentiation of farming techniques and also products within the context of large-scale as well as very consistent systems of production (Kumar, 2009).
